by jdsun1 » Sun Apr 15, 2007 10:55 pm
Jschmuck2 wrote:Yahoo is going to review it...how does that usually work??
If its a public league there is such thing as a fair play policy and you can send them an email with the league info and the situationa dn they will veto it and then send you an email about it. The turnaround time is about 20-30 minutes and usually they veto it. This one would definately get veteod if you protested to yahoo about it.
